Output f1828038fa87ab3f38464c5dfb76f1dbb5537953aea507b559bb62d4d00e99e2:0

value
705682
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a0beb4f2444de2eb1f46e57ee2dabb03923142bd OP_EQUALVERIFY OP_CHECKSIG
address
1FewaEdzvVFbhXtzRvcEvTYbr2gmycbeMK
transaction
f1828038fa87ab3f38464c5dfb76f1dbb5537953aea507b559bb62d4d00e99e2
confirmations
382648
spent
true